‘Balkan Hospitality Opens Doors: Studying Dialects on the Verge of Extinction
You cannot study spoken dialects from books. Instead, you need to go to a village, seek out its elders, and earn the trust of local residents before you can record hours of spontaneous stories. This is how Natalia Muravleva, Associate Professor at the Faculty of Humanities, conducts her research. Her internship in Serbia continued her long-standing study of dialects spoken by Macedonian settlers. In this interview, she discusses how diaspora cultural centres help researchers reach informants, why native speakers need to be interviewed only in their own language (otherwise, as she puts it, they may 'break'), and how a single field season helped her finalise her monograph. She also shares warm memories of autumn in Belgrade and of colleagues with whom grammar can be discussed in three languages at once.

Scientists Train Neural Network to Generate Process Plans from 3D Models
Researchers at the HSE FCS AI and Digital Science Institute have developed CAD2TechSpec, a framework that converts 3D models of mechanical parts into machining process plans—step-by-step instructions for machine tools. The solution aims to reduce the time required for the design and preparation of technical process documentation in mechanical engineering, aircraft manufacturing, and other high-tech industries. The study findings have been published in PeerJ Computer Science.

Выбор стандарта беспроводной связи для нательной системы захвата движения

С. 328–335.
Petukhov A. A.

Human interaction with the virtual environment remains one of the problems when introducing virtual (VR) and Augmented (AR) technologies in such areas as education, industry, medicine, games, and other areas. In this paper, a description of the human motion capture system that serves as a human-computer interface for VR and AR applications is given. Comparative analysis of wireless communication standards and modeling of the 802.15.4-based motion capture system were conducted. IEEE 802.11 Wi-Fi, IEEE 802.15.1 Bluetooth, IEEE 802.15.4, and IEEE 802.15.6 standards are considered.

Language: Russian
